One week after the Lifetime channel will air Jodi Arias: Dirty Little Secret, the popular women's friendly network will premiere the biopic about late stripper-turned-model Anna Nicole Smith.

Lifetime's original movie The Ann Nicole Story on air on June 29, one week after the movie produced about the Arias murder trial.

Actress Agnes Bruckner, 27, will play Smith, whose birth name was Vickie Lynn Hogan. Martina Landau, 84, will star as billionaire J. Howard Marshall. The latter met Smith in a strip club and they later married.

Bruckner previously appeared in The Craigslist Killer and ABC's Private Practice. Virginia Madsen, Adam Goldberg and Cary Elwe will also appear in The Anna Nicole Story.

The film follows the story about the rise and fall of the small-town Texas woman who, as a single mother, worked in a strip club. At her job she met Marshall, an oil tycoon, and eventually married him when she was 26 and he was 89. Smith later became a successful fashion model and a poster girl for the Guess? clothing ad campaign. She was also a Playboy model, and her lifestyle and drug use made her a regular fixture in the tabloids until her death at the age of 39 from an overdose of prescription drugs in Hollywood, Fla.

Smith's death in February of 2007 took place less than six months after she gave birth to her second child. Her daughter Danielynn was born in September of 2006, the same month Smith's 20-year-old son Daniel died from drug use.

Since Marshall's death in 1995, his family has maintained an ongoing legal court battle to prevent Smith and now her estate from inheriting his fortune. On May 30, TMZ reported that a judge ruled that Smith's daughter is entitled to legal sanctions against Marshall's family. The value of the sanctions could land her a settlement up to $49 million.
